    Hi Adel:

    I will give my view on the take of some on this forum. If someone wants to add something please do.

    Much easier to understand now. What about Yuan Chi? My understanding
    was that it was neutral in the sense that it is chi that has not
    quite been polarized yet, but not totally neutral in the sense that
    because it is in this plane (5 phase) that there has to be a certain
    amount of polarization. (?)
    ***********************
    In the model they use here, they split the universe in at least two realms. Pre=heaven and Post-heaven, or Early and Later Heaven.

    They like to make correspondences between the two realms. In our life now. Yuan Chi is created all the time, it is the ming-men fire cooking Jing/Essence, which creates a steam, which is Yuan Qi. It is the Qi from Jing that is housed in the kidneys. It is believed we have a limited amount in our body at birth. A healthy person has enough for our allotted 100 years.

    What some present here is there is a Yuan Qi (Original Qi) of nature, we can call this the early heaven realm. It is not in our body. And it is proposed we can access it and gather it to nourish and rejuvenate our body and sprit. And connecting to it connects us to this other realm. The quality of this Qi is non-polar or limited polarity. It can take any form, like a stem cell. In theory, it would be like Wu Ji, it can become anything.

    In there view, they seek to connect to the other realm to support “growth” in this realm. This idea is part of indigenous Chinese culture, where there was ancestor worship and medicine. A goal was to communicate with the ancestors and appease the ancestors, which then will create auspicious harvests, fertility and longevity. So in the view here, they want to connect to immortals, beings, planets and stars, instead of ancestors, and connect to Qi, instead of the Gods we find in Taoism that follows this way.

    Hope this helps.
